Ecological Sustainability In Energy Regulation
Introduction
Ecological sustainability in energy regulation refers to the legal and regulatory requirement that energy generation, transmission, distribution, and consumption should be planned and operated without causing unacceptable long-term damage to ecosystems, biodiversity, forests, wildlife, water resources, air quality, and the rights of future generations. Energy regulation traditionally focuses on electricity supply, affordability, reliability, investment, and energy security. Modern environmental jurisprudence requires these objectives to be considered together with ecological protection.
In India, ecological sustainability is connected with Article 21 of the Constitution, Article 48A, Article 51A(g), the public trust doctrine, the precautionary principle, the polluter-pays principle, and the principle of sustainable development. The Supreme Court has repeatedly recognised that development and environmental protection must be reconciled rather than treated as mutually exclusive objectives.
Meaning of Ecological Sustainability in Energy Regulation
Energy projects can have significant ecological consequences. Thermal power generation may create air pollution, ash disposal, water consumption, and greenhouse-gas emissions. Hydroelectric projects can affect rivers, forests, wildlife habitats, and local ecosystems. Renewable-energy projects generally reduce dependence on fossil fuels but may still require land, transmission infrastructure, and biodiversity-sensitive planning.
Ecological sustainability therefore requires regulators to consider the complete environmental life cycle of an energy project. Environmental clearance, impact assessment, wildlife protection, forest conservation, pollution control, mitigation measures, monitoring, and restoration obligations become important components of energy governance.
The objective is not necessarily to prohibit development. Instead, the regulatory framework should ensure that energy development remains compatible with ecological limits and intergenerational interests.
Constitutional Foundation
Article 21 has been interpreted by the Supreme Court as encompassing the right to a clean and healthy environment. Article 48A directs the State to protect and improve the environment and safeguard forests and wildlife, while Article 51A(g) places a corresponding environmental responsibility upon citizens. The Court has also recognised the public trust doctrine, under which the State acts as trustee of important natural resources for the benefit of the public.
These constitutional principles influence energy regulation because electricity infrastructure frequently depends upon natural resources such as land, water, forests, minerals, and ecological corridors.
Sustainable Development as a Regulatory Principle
Sustainable development requires environmental protection and economic development to be considered together. The Supreme Court has explained that development and environmental protection are not necessarily enemies and that appropriate safeguards can permit development while reducing environmental harm.
For energy regulators, this means that decisions concerning power plants, transmission corridors, hydroelectric facilities, renewable-energy installations, and energy infrastructure should account for ecological consequences rather than examining electricity production in isolation.
Precautionary Principle
The precautionary principle is particularly important where scientific uncertainty exists. Where an activity creates a threat of serious or irreversible environmental damage, lack of complete scientific certainty should not automatically justify postponing preventive measures. The Supreme Court has expressly recognised this principle as part of Indian environmental jurisprudence.
In energy regulation, the principle can influence environmental assessment, location of infrastructure, protection of endangered species, pollution controls, and requirements for mitigation.
Public Trust Doctrine
The public trust doctrine requires the State to treat important natural resources as resources held for public benefit rather than simply as commodities available for unrestricted exploitation. The Supreme Court has reaffirmed that natural resources such as forests, rivers, and other ecological assets are subject to this principle.
Consequently, an energy project involving a sensitive river, forest, wildlife habitat, or other ecological resource must be evaluated not merely according to its economic value but also according to the State's responsibility to protect the resource for present and future generations.
Important Case Laws
1. M.C. Mehta v. Union of India, (2004) 12 SCC 118
The Supreme Court explained the relationship between environmental protection and development while discussing the precautionary principle. The Court recognised that projects involving industries, irrigation, and power generation may proceed where appropriate safeguards and sustainable-development principles are applied. The decision demonstrates that environmental regulation should seek an appropriate balance rather than treating economic development and ecological protection as automatically incompatible.
2. Vellore Citizens' Welfare Forum v. Union of India, (1996) 5 SCC 647
This landmark decision established that the precautionary principle and polluter-pays principle are essential features of Indian environmental law. It also recognised sustainable development as an important principle governing environmental decision-making. For energy regulation, the case supports the proposition that environmental costs cannot simply be externalised while assessing the economic benefits of energy projects.
3. M.C. Mehta v. Kamal Nath, (1997) 1 SCC 388
The Supreme Court recognised the public trust doctrine in Indian law. Natural resources are held by the State in trust for the public. The principle is significant for energy projects involving rivers, water bodies, forests, and other common ecological resources because regulatory authorities must consider the continuing public interest in preserving those resources.
4. T.N. Godavarman Thirumulpad v. Union of India
The long-running Godavarman litigation significantly developed Indian forest and ecological jurisprudence. The Supreme Court has repeatedly emphasised effective enforcement of environmental laws and the importance of protecting ecological resources. In its later orders, the Court has stressed that sustainable development requires protection and conservation of natural resources for present and future generations.
5. Hanuman Laxman Aroskar v. Union of India, (2019) 15 SCC 401
The Supreme Court examined environmental clearance and emphasised the importance of a meaningful environmental decision-making process. Environmental assessment cannot be treated merely as a procedural formality. For energy infrastructure, the case reinforces the importance of properly considering environmental information before regulatory approval.
6. Alembic Pharmaceuticals Ltd. v. Rohit Prajapati, (2020) 17 SCC 157
The Supreme Court emphasised the importance of prior environmental clearance and rejected the idea that environmental regulation can simply be regularised after an activity has already commenced. The principle has significance for energy projects because environmental compliance must form part of project planning rather than being treated as an afterthought.
7. M.K. Ranjitsinh v. Union of India, 2024 INSC 280
This is particularly important for ecological sustainability in renewable-energy regulation. The case concerned protection of the Great Indian Bustard and the potential collision risk created by overhead transmission lines. The Court considered both biodiversity conservation and India's need to expand renewable energy. It modified its earlier blanket restrictions and adopted a more holistic, expert-informed approach. The Court specifically discussed the relationship between climate-change protection, renewable energy, biodiversity, and the right to a healthy environment.
The case demonstrates that even environmentally beneficial energy sources can produce local ecological impacts. Sustainable energy regulation therefore requires consideration of both climate benefits and biodiversity consequences.
8. M.K. Ranjitsinh v. Union of India, 2025 INSC 1472
In its later 2025 judgment, the Supreme Court continued addressing the interaction between Great Indian Bustard conservation and renewable-energy infrastructure. The Court considered expert recommendations concerning priority areas, transmission corridors, and conservation measures. The judgment illustrates an increasingly sophisticated approach in which renewable-energy expansion and ecological protection are addressed through evidence-based regulatory mechanisms rather than treating either objective as absolute.
Ecological Sustainability and Energy Regulators
Energy regulators can incorporate ecological sustainability through environmental conditions attached to approvals, renewable-energy planning, ecological impact assessments, transmission-route planning, pollution standards, water-use requirements, biodiversity safeguards, monitoring obligations, and restoration requirements.
The regulatory process should also remain transparent and reasoned. Where ecological risks are identified, authorities should explain how those risks were considered and why particular mitigation measures are sufficient. This strengthens accountability and facilitates judicial review where necessary.
Intergenerational Equity
Ecological sustainability also incorporates intergenerational equity. Natural resources used for present energy needs must not be depleted or degraded to such an extent that future generations inherit substantially reduced ecological choices.
This principle is especially relevant to energy policy because energy infrastructure often has long operational lives. Decisions concerning coal, hydroelectric resources, transmission corridors, renewable-energy installations, and energy-storage systems can influence ecological conditions for decades.
Conclusion
Ecological sustainability in energy regulation represents the integration of environmental protection into the legal governance of energy systems. Indian environmental jurisprudence does not require development to stop; rather, it requires development to operate within constitutional, statutory, ecological, and intergenerational constraints.
The principles of sustainable development, precaution, public trust, polluter pays, environmental protection under Article 21, and intergenerational equity collectively provide the legal foundation. The decisions in Vellore Citizens' Welfare Forum, M.C. Mehta, Kamal Nath, Godavarman, Hanuman Laxman Aroskar, Alembic Pharmaceuticals, and particularly M.K. Ranjitsinh demonstrate how courts have increasingly connected environmental protection with infrastructure and energy decisions.
The central regulatory lesson is that sustainability must be considered throughout the energy system—from project selection and environmental assessment to construction, operation, transmission, monitoring, and eventual restoration. Energy security and ecological security therefore operate as interconnected dimensions of responsible energy governance rather than isolated regulatory objectives.
